LL CH 20MA WATER TEMPERATURE: 
TEMPERATURE OR NONE 
 
CH 4MA WATER TEMPERATURE: 
TEMPERATURE OR NONE 
These provide the 20mA and 4mA temperatures 
for the interpolation curve. If either of these have 
the None value, are invalid, are out of range, or 
are too close for interpolation, an alert is issued 
and the setpoint reverts to "Local"  when it is 
selected as 4-20mA. 
 
LL CH SETPOINT: DEGREES OR NONE 
This setpoint is used when the time-of-day input 
is off. If  the ODR function is inactive then the 
setpoint is used as-is.  If the ODR function is 
active then this setpoint provides one coordinate 
for the outdoor reset curve. 
 
LL CH TOD SETPOINT: DEGREES OR NONE  
This setpoint is used when the time-of-day input 
is on. If the ODR function is inactive then the 
setpoint is used as-is. 
 
If the ODR function is active then this setpoint 
provides one coordinate for the shifted (because 
TOD is on) outdoor reset curve. 
 
TIME OF DAY 
The Time of Day has one sources of control: a 
switch contact. Closed TOD is an on condition; 
open, then TOD is off.

The outdoor reset function requires the outdoor 
temperature. This temperature may be obtained 
from either a local sensor or a LL slave as 
described earlier. If the outdoor temperature is 
invalid and unknown, then no outdoor reset 
action occurs and an alert is issued indicating an 
invalid outdoor temperature. 
 
LL CH ODR MINIMUM WATER 
TEMPERATURE: DEGREES OR NONE 
 
This specifies the minimum outdoor reset 
setpoint for the LL master. If the outdoor reset 
function calculates a temperature that is below 
the temperature specified here, then this 
parameter's temperature will be used. If this 
parameter is invalid or None then the outdoor 
reset function will be inhibited and will not run: if 
it is enabled then an alert is issued.

LL OFF HYSTERESIS: DEGREES OR NONE 
 
LL ON HYSTERESIS: DEGREES OR NONE 
 
The LL hysteresis values apply to all setpoint 
sources. The behavior of the hysteresis function 
is identical to the behavior of the stand-alone CH 
hysteresis function, except: 
 
• where stand-alone CH hysteresis uses the 
on/off status of a single burner, the LL hysteresis 
uses the on/off status of all slave burners: this 
status is true if any slave burner is on, and false 
only if all are off. 
• where stand-alone CH hysteresis uses time of 
turn-on and turn-off of a single burner, the LL 
hysteresis uses the turn-on of the first slave 
burners and the turn-off of the last slave burner.
